- Abstract : Cu-TCPP nanosheets exhibit a high density of active sites and low diffusion barriers for styrene epoxidation. Abstract : 2D MOF nanostructures have shown promising properties in heterogeneous catalysis. Herein, we synthesized ultrathin 2D Cu-porphyrin MOF nanosheets and demonstrated their excellent catalytic performance in styrene oxidation (94% conversion efficiency), which was attributed to the material's high density of exposed active sites and low diffusion barriers.
